Eleanor Umeyor successful in youth appeal against sentence
Eleanor Umeyor’s youth client was sentenced to a 10-month Detention and Training Order following a guilty plea at the earliest opportunity to s.20 GBH, ABH and having a bladed article in a public place. The sentence was appealed as manifestly excessive. The appeal was allowed by Snaresbrook Crown Court and the client was re-sentenced to a Youth Rehabilitation Order with Intensive Supervision and Surveillance.
Eleanor was instructed by Lauren Alphonse of AB Mackenzie Solicitors.
